Manganese is an essential element used primarily in steel production
. Its addition to steel enhances the material's strength, toughness, and durability. This versatile mineral mitigates the risk of steel brittleness and improves its resistance to abrasive wear, making it invaluable in many engineering and construction applications. In the production of steel, manganese acts as a sulfur fixer and deoxidizer, preventing unwanted reactions that can compromise the integrity of the final product. By removing oxygen and sulfur impurities, manganese contributes to a cleaner, more refined steel with superior mechanical properties.

High-manganese steel, commonly referred to as Hadfield steel, contains approximately 11-15% manganese. This particular alloy is renowned for its exceptional wear resistance, which is why it's often used in the manufacturing of heavy-duty machinery and equipment, such as railroad tracks, rock crushers, and armor plating. Its non-magnetic nature also makes it suitable for use in anti-magnetic applications.
